summaryThis conversation explores the unique perspectives of the Gospels, particularly focusing on the historical context of the Hebrew people, the rise and rule of Herod the Great, and the implications of Jesus' birth in relation to Herod's tyranny. It delves into the narrative parallels between Moses and Jesus, the significance of lamentation as a form of resistance, and the overarching theme of power dynamics in biblical history. The discussion culminates in reflections on authenticity and the nature of silence in the face of oppression.

takeaways

  • Different Gospels target different audiences with unique perspectives.
  • Herod the Great's rule was marked by violence and political maneuvering.
  • The historical context of the Hebrew people is crucial to understanding the Gospels.
  • Herod's fear of losing power led to the slaughter of innocent children.
  • The narrative aligns Jesus with Moses, framing him as a new leader.
  • God communicates through dreams, bypassing traditional power structures.
  • Lamentation is a vital form of resistance against oppression.
  • Herod's death symbolizes the triumph of Jesus' life and message.
  • Matthew's account seeks to correct the narrative surrounding Herod.
  • Silence can lead to authenticity and self-discovery.
